  • Naloxone Training

    Thursday, October 17th 2024
    5:30 PM - 6:30 PM

    Event Location: MLC 214

    *FYOS approved* 

    Save a life and stop opioid overdoses! Learn what an overdose is, what the signs and symptoms of an overdose are and how Naloxone and the OneBox are distributed across campus.

    The Georgia Department of Public Health since 2022 has reported an increase in accidental opioid overdoses across the state of Georgia as a result of substances being contaminated with fentanyl.

    Saving a life is the number one priority during an overdose.

    While the majority of the UGA community does not consume alcohol or other recreational substances, opioid overdoses can occur under a number of different circumstances.

    No different than AED/CPR first aid boxes that are placed strategically across campus, ONEbox units will also be available in case of an overdose situation. This program is a collaborative effort between The Fontaine Center, University Health Center Pharmacy, and other Student Affairs offices. Members of the UGA community can find a ONEBox which contains Naloxone as well as video instructions on how to administer it included within the boxes. ONEbox technology was developed by the West Virginia Drug Intervention Institute. Participate in this training to learn how the OneBox can help everyone to be an upstander and intervene if someone is in need of help.
